Despite only coming on towards the end of the second half, Jacob Murphy had a huge impact in Newcastle United’s 5-1 win against Aston Villa- notably assisting Harvey Barnes’ debut goal.

However, as United fans know, his off-pitch antics is where the footballer has solidified himself as a cult hero. His main arena? Lurking in the comments section of his teammates’ Instagram comments.

His main target? Anthony Gordon.

Last season the 28-year-old was incredibly active in Gordon’s comments, dubbing him ‘Starboy Malfoy’, a joke which progressed and morphed into even sillier comments such as ‘Expelliarmus bro.’

And yesterday Murphy continued his efforts albeit in a more cryptic way.

Underneath the 22-year-old’s post commemorating Newcastle’s win, Murphy commenting ‘Dinky doo 😮‍💨🔥’

Now, I’m not going to pretend to understand exactly what this means. However ‘dinky’ is used to describe something small and delicate. A lovable roast between teammates perhaps, or, rather, Murphy might be complimenting Gordon’s incredibly agile and graceful performance at St James’ Park.

Incredibly, there is also another option. Dinky Doo is in fact a My Little Pony character. A purple cartoon with a blonde main, hilariously, it’s quite easy to see the comparison.
